Gateway Ticketing Systems, a leading provider of admission control systems, has announced the promotion of Joe Marshall to managing director, where he will be in charge of the group as they develop and broaden their presence in the attractions sector.
As a Project Manager who joined Gateway in 2017, Marshall rapidly made a name for himself by committing to providing quality solutions to both new and existing clients in the UK and Europe. He has been the general manager of Gateway Ticketing Systems UK Limited since April 2021.
Popular with clients
Marshall has assumed control of the UK office, where he has started cultivating new connections and bringing new life to the company’s activities. Under his leadership, the UK office and team have advanced significantly over the past 16 months with the company reporting its recent success is largely attributable to his understanding of the market and effective client relationship management.
The executive has spent three decades in leadership and technology, including 4 years as Zonal Retail Data Systems’ head of projects and 13 years as Omnico Group’s solution delivery manager. Marshall managed teams, projects, and budgets in both positions.
